鶹Լ honored with ‘鶹Լ University Day’ proclamation from the City of Decatur

April 30, 2026, is designated in recognition of the University’s 125th anniversary and community impact.

DECATUR, Ill. —  was recognized during Monday’s Decatur City Council meeting as the City of Decatur officially proclaimed  in honor of the institution’s 125th anniversary.

Lori Kerans, Vice President for Athletics and Community Engagement, read the proclamation during the meeting, highlighting the University’s longstanding contributions to the city and region.

Issued by Decatur Mayor Julie Moore Wolfe, the proclamation recognizes 鶹Լ’s role as a “steadfast and transformative anchor institution” in Decatur for more than a century, citing its impact on education, cultural enrichment, workforce development, and economic growth.

Founded in 1901, 鶹Լ has served generations of students through its Performance Learning approach, which integrates classroom instruction with hands-on, real-world experiences. The proclamation notes that this model prepares graduates for professional success, civic engagement, and meaningful lives, while maintaining strong ties to the Decatur community.

As “Decatur’s University,” 鶹Լ continues to play a vital role in the city’s cultural and civic life through performances, exhibitions, service initiatives, and partnerships with local organizations. The City’s recognition also acknowledges the University’s ongoing commitment to expanding access to higher education and preparing future leaders who will contribute to the vitality of the region and beyond.

The designation of “鶹Լ University Day” coincides with the Founder’s Day celebration on April 30 and serves as a key milestone in its 125th anniversary year. The proclamation also comes on the heels of the , marking a period of continued momentum and renewed vision for the University.

The proclamation’s full text is as follows: 

OFFICIAL PROCLAMATION
CITY OF DECATUR, ILLINOIS

 WHEREAS: 鶹Լ University has been a steadfast and transformative anchor institution in the Decatur community for 125 years, contributing significantly to the region’s educational enrichment, cultural vitality, workforce development and economic strength, and

WHEREAS: Founded in 1901, 鶹Լ University has served generations of students through its distinctive Performance Learning approach, preparing graduates for professional success, democratic citizenship in a global environment, and personal lives of meaning and value while remaining deeply rooted in the Decatur community, and

WHEREAS: Serving as Decatur’s University, 鶹Լ has empowered students to combine knowledge with practice throughout the College of Arts & Sciences, College of Fine Arts, College of Professional Studies and the Tabor School of Business, producing alumni who make lasting contributions locally, nationally and around the world, and

WHEREAS: 鶹Լ University enriches the cultural and civic life of Decatur and the surrounding community through performances, exhibitions, lectures, service initiatives and community partnerships that reflect its enduring commitment to collaboration and shared progress, and

WHEREAS: As it celebrates its 125th anniversary and the recent inauguration of its 17th President, Dr. Dean A. Pribbenow, 鶹Լ University honors the vision of its founders, the dedication of its faculty and staff, and the loyalty and generosity of its alumni and friends whose collective support has sustained and strengthened the institution across generations, and

WHEREAS: 鶹Լ University remains committed to expanding access and affordability in higher education, fostering innovation and opportunity, and shaping the next generation of leaders who will contribute to the vitality of Decatur and beyond,

NOW THEREFORE, I, Julie Moore Wolfe, Mayor of the City of Decatur, do hereby proclaim April 30, 2026, 鶹Լ’s Founder’s Day, as “鶹Լ University Day” in honor of their 125th anniversary.

Done on this day, April 20, 2026.
